The Eduard-Wallnöfer Center ( EWZ , even Tilak Competence Center TCC) is a university and research center in the municipality of Hall in Tirol in District Innsbruck-Land , Tirol . The focus is on medical innovation.

geography

The Eduard Wallnöfer Center is located almost 9 kilometers east of Innsbruck , on the north-eastern edge of the town of Hall bei Schönegg , directly adjacent to the Hall State Hospital . The area comprises around 7  hectares of park area and - in the first construction phase around 2003 with two building complexes - 25,000 m² of building space. There are also a few buildings up to Aichatstrasse (psychiatry).

History and organization

Hall in Tirol has been a hospital since 1342, with the Hospital of the Holy Spirit on the lower town square, from 1845 on the Damenstift, which moved to the Knoll estate that was acquired in 1911 ( General District Hospital Hall  BKH). Adjacent in Thurnfeldgasse was the k. k. Hall in Tirol lunatic asylum (later  PKH psychiatric hospital ). Both provincial hospitals (BKH, PKH) of the then Tyrolean provincial hospitals, now Tirol Kliniken , were merged in 2011 to form the provincial hospital  (LKH) . In October 2001 the Private University for Medical Informatics and Technology Tyrol (today for Health Sciences, Medical Informatics and Technology  UMIT) was founded in Innsbruck as a subsidiary of the State of Tyrol. Tyrol had not previously had its own medical university, but in 2004 the Medical University of Innsbruck  (I-MED) was created from the renowned medical faculty of the University of Innsbruck , which gave rise to two teaching centers. It was therefore decided to relocate UMIT to Hall in order to set up an innovation center for medical technology and IT.

The groundbreaking ceremony was in spring 2003, after 18 months of construction, the Eduard Wallnöfer Center was officially opened on October 26, 2004 . Around 2.5 million euros were invested in the first construction phase. The complex is named after Eduard Wallnöfer (1913–1989), long-time governor of Tyrol, who managed to disguise his membership in the NSDAP after the end of the Second World War ; this only became known again in 2005. UMIT moved to the new campus in the 2004/2005 winter semester. At the beginning, studies in biomedical informatics, health sciences and a course in disaster and crisis management were offered here - in addition to Innsbruck, Hall is also a central air ambulance location . The LKH was expanded to become an academic teaching hospital . At the same time, the West Training Center for Health Professions  (AZW) of the Tirol Clinics was established as a second location.

A department of the Austrian Institute of Technology  AIT ( Research Center Seibersdorf ) has also been stationed since 2006 . The center became an important partner in the Austrian cancer research program Oncotyrol in Innsbruck, the COMET K1 competence center for cancer monitoring and genome research, and is increasingly focusing on international projects with the Europa-Akademie (EURAK). In 2010, UMIT was hit by a quality crisis when the Accreditation Council withdrew the approval for a degree program and reports were made about the poor quality of the dissertations.

Around 2012 around 1000 students are enrolled at UMIT, and around 100 scientists, professors, visiting professors and trainers, as well as another 50 employees, are active.

The campus - the infrastructure projects - is operated by TCC  Errichtungs- und Betriebsgesellschaft  mbH (TCC E&B, TILAK Competence Center ), 51% owned by Tirol Kliniken  GmbH and 49% owned by UMIT-Holdinggesellschaft, both country daughters.

architecture

The center is characterized by a striking modern architecture that is embedded in the old trees of the park. She comes from the team henke and schreieck (Dieter Henke, Marta Schreieck)

Building No. 1, the main building on the southeast corner of the area, is a mighty atrium building , on a square floor plan with 60 meters of edge, partly three and partly four storeys due to the hillside location (park and street level). The facade is closed all around in storey-high sun protection louvers and opened up through some incisions in the body. The interior is sober, the spacious auditorium opens up to the institute wings, the atrium, and connects the two entrance levels on two floors. The forum on the first floor of the courtyard is roofed with glass.

The dormitory and kindergarten form building no. 2 to the north, also a square closed to the outside, the open inner courtyard with outside stairs and terraces. The common rooms are located on the fully glazed inner wall and allow continuous visual contact, the rooms face outwards with a view of the landscape.

The second construction phase ( Competence Center , west of the main building, towards the LKH) is being planned and should be developed by the same architectural office.
